Part-taking in the
Innovation academy and Catalyst last year has really been my first experience
with entrepreneurship. Throughout my time in IA, I have created a biodegradable
condom and a child’s puzzle that teaches braille. I never considered myself to be a creative
person until I took creativity in context and invented a biodegradable condom.
Throughout the process I learned the importance of product research and
interviewing experts. I interviewed an environmental sciences student studying
at University of Florida, when prompted with the prototype he was immediately
intrigued and really endorsed Bee Safe as a whole concept. We had to look into better alternatives for the environment because the
chemicals and parabens put into condoms make them very hard to break-down, we also had to research alternatives, like lambskin condoms but those can be off-putting. I
created the idea, logo, branding, and poster. My team and I presented the
prototype and business model at Catalyst, earning us the people’s choice award
and teaching us a lot about what it is like to create a start-up company. I
hope that ENT3003 will foster that knowledge and hopefully find a connection to
my neuropsychology major.
